Frequently Asked Questions about Furnished Bushrod Apartments

What is the Cheapest Furnished apartment in Bushrod?

Currently the most affordable Furnished Apartment in Bushrod is at ArtHaus Telegraph listed at $1,031.

How much is the average rent for a Furnished Bushrod Apartment?

The average rent for a Furnished Apartment in Bushrod is $2,711.

What is the largest Furnished Bushrod Apartment for rent?

Today's Furnished apartment with the most square footage in Bushrod is a 1,440 square feet unit starting from $6,295 at 2803 Telegraph Ave, Unit 2803 telegraph.
